Summary

Hosts Curtis and Soren discuss the Kansas City Royals' historic nine-game winning streak, debating whether it helps young players or merely hurts draft position. They express concern that front office complacency will prevent necessary roster changes, citing poor scouting and questionable moves like playing Salvador Perez at first base. The episode also covers minor league prospects, the Chiefs' recent guard acquisition, and listener calls regarding team management and draft rules.
